Default Cleaning windshield - advice

Can anyone recommend a heavy duty glass cleaner or technique?

I am getting haze marks on the windshield, in particularwhere the passenger side wiper stops (comes to top of arc) in front of the driver's side (2002 X). It seems to leave a deposit when it stops there - perhaps silicone from the blade? Dunno but it is annoying.

I've tried regular glass cleaner, auto glass cleaner, simple green, razor blades, fine steel wool (always did the trick when I was a detailer), and turtle wax rubbing compound. None have worked to remove the haze, although the rubbing compound did seem to clean it better than anything else.

Oh yeah, I tried a claybar too. Nope.
